How does GDP affect the value of cryptocurrencies?

In what ways does the Gross Domestic Product (GDP) impact the value of cryptocurrencies?

5 answers
- The Gross Domestic Product (GDP) can have a significant impact on the value of cryptocurrencies. When the GDP of a country is growing, it indicates a healthy economy and increased consumer spending power. This can lead to a higher demand for cryptocurrencies as people look for alternative investment opportunities. On the other hand, when the GDP is shrinking or experiencing a recession, it can create uncertainty and decrease the demand for cryptocurrencies. Additionally, the GDP growth rate can also influence the value of cryptocurrencies. Higher GDP growth rates may attract more investors and increase the value of cryptocurrencies.

- The impact of GDP on cryptocurrencies can vary depending on the specific cryptocurrency and the country in question. While a growing GDP can generally be seen as positive for cryptocurrencies, it's important to consider other factors such as government regulations and market sentiment. Additionally, the relationship between GDP and cryptocurrencies is not one-sided. Cryptocurrencies can also have an impact on the GDP by promoting financial inclusion and facilitating cross-border transactions. Overall, it's a complex relationship that requires careful analysis and consideration.
